Output d6b3d2d417820faa3075ec736e7cef937f7e631f2ccf3ed7faffd1ec0a70e749:1

value
6945683835459
script pubkey
OP_0 OP_PUSHBYTES_20 ecf1b0ac0314900c5440ed3eaaff737e9e8bcc3c
address
tb1qancmptqrzjgqc4zqa5l24lmn060ghnpunqspvj
transaction
d6b3d2d417820faa3075ec736e7cef937f7e631f2ccf3ed7faffd1ec0a70e749
confirmations
134249
spent
true